HOW WE PROTECT IT

Data Handling And Account Security Steps

We store account and wallet reference data on secured servers and limit internal access to staff who need it to process a deposit, verify a withdrawal, or answer a support ticket. Login sessions use device checks so an unfamiliar phone or browser triggers extra verification before it reaches your wallet balance. We keep transaction records only as long as needed for account history and dispute checks, then they're scheduled for removal. If you want to update stored details or ask what's on file, our support channels above are the starting point — how much we can share still follows your local law and the eligibility of your region.

Encrypted Account Storage

Your login credentials and wallet references sit behind encrypted storage, separate from browsing activity on slot rooms or the Football Betonsite markets you visit.

Session And Device Checks

A new device or browser logging into your account triggers a verification step, so a stolen password alone can't move funds through bKash, Nagad or Rocket.

Retention And Deletion Windows

We keep deposit and withdrawal records only as long as account history and dispute resolution require, after which they move into scheduled deletion queues.

Requesting A Change

Ask through support to check, correct or close out data tied to your account; we confirm your identity against your registered mobile number first.
